Christmas light cookies, literally Christmas light cookies, are delightful decorated cookies that are easy to make and very appetizing.
Simple butter cookies decorated with icing, colorful sprinkles, and chocolate (or with a black food marker to draw the wires), easy to make even with the little ones, perfect to leave for Santa Claus, along with carrots for the reindeer, on Christmas Eve night, but also for a delicious Christmas-themed snack!

Ingredients for the Christmas light cookies
- 2 1/16 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 5 1/3 tbsp butter
- 1 egg
- 2 cups powdered sugar
- 1/3 cup water (or as needed)
- 3 oz dark chocolate (or a black food coloring marker)
- colorful sprinkles
Tools
- 1 Food marker
Preparation of the Christmas light cookies
In a large bowl, place the softened butter cut into pieces, the egg, and 1/2 cup of sugar and mix them into a cream with electric beaters.
Add the flour gradually, until it is all incorporated.
Spread the prepared mixture onto a sheet of plastic wrap and, using the plastic underneath, compact it to form a loaf.
Let it rest in the refrigerator for thirty minutes.After the resting time, roll out the dough on a lightly floured surface and cut out the cookies with a round cookie cutter or a glass.
Place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, keeping them slightly spaced apart, and bake them in a preheated fan oven at 350°F for ten minutes.
Remove from the oven and let them cool completely.Sift the powdered sugar into a small bowl and make a well in the center.
Pour in the water, a little at a time, stirring until you get a thick but homogeneous mixture.
If not using the black food marker, melt the chocolate in a bain-marie or in the microwave.
Cover the cookies with the icing and let it set slightly.Create the wires with melted chocolate placed in a pastry bag with a small nozzle or with a toothpick (or draw them using the black food marker, being careful not to press too hard to avoid breaking the icing) and place the colorful sprinkles underneath to form the lights (pressing lightly on the icing to attach them).
Let cool completely, then store your Christmas light cookies in a tin or airtight container.
